Middle Men Menace - Root Causes

1. Most people do have not proper knowledge of processes at Government Departments
2. Most corporates and citizens don't have much time to spend on long and hectic processes
3. Government Departments do not have any Key Performance Indicators (KPI/KRAs). They don't take any responsibility to improve Turn Around Times (TATs)
4. E Governance is not popular yet
5. Lack of transparency in law
6. No commitment for completion of jobs by Government officers
7. There is a strong nexus between Government officers and these middle men
8. A lot of middle men also have political contacts
9. Through the middle men channel, the Government officers don’t take bribe directly from citizens but get the bribe indirectly
10. Middle men manipulate the law of supply and demand to their favour
11. There is a lack of awareness among common people
12. The only motive of the middle men is to earn more and more money out of a transaction
13. Middle men know how to get things moving and what is absolutely required for things to happen fast
14. Middle men are not afraid of law as they are used to bribing and getting let off
15. No stringent measures/law against the presence of middlemen

Middle Men Menace - Key Issues

1. In India middle men are involved in almost all the sectors
2. Middle men lead to an increase in the prices of goods
3. Middle men charge a commission
4. Government officers themselves point customers towards the middle men so that they could make money without taking bribes themselves
5. Middle men are involved in hoarding
6. Middle men lead to increase in the time taken for the goods to reach the end consumer
7. Middle men increase the turn-around time of the service delivery
8. In some Government departments, you just cannot get work done until you go through a middle man
9. Middle men exploit the knowledge gap of the consumer
10. Some middle men mislead and take advantage of the situation more

We have seen many Agents/Middle men's menace in Government Offices such as, RTO, Income Tax, Sales Tax, Rationing Office, Taluk Offices, Village Offices, Panchayats, Municipality etc. 1. The above menace has become difficult for common man who directly approaches the above Offices to get the work done. 2. The work can be done within one or two days , is taking more than 5-6 days due to harrassment by the Officers, they ask you to come tommorrow just for a signature from his boss. 3. Several windows to be approached for each action , such as, One counter for form filling, another for submission, another for verification, another for signature, then put up counter , they will ask you to come next day, next day the put up will take place, to collect come after two days. Like that several harrassment from Govt. Departments for individual. 4. Whereas, the agents/Middlemen are getting the work done fast there and then by paying money to Officer secretly. 5. Govt. should stop forthwith the agents/middlemen's menace and only accept direct online windows. 6. Initiate a single form system and single window system. 7. For example, RTO office - One form which should include all actions from beginning to the end . Now there are more than 50 forms available. All forms are asking the same information of vehicle and the action column is the only extra thing. 8. Hence, simplify, for example as under: a) Owners details and Vehicle details b) Octroi payment details c) Registration fee paid and details/ Green tax/ Penalty/fine etc./change of owner d) Licence form details column/Change of address e) FIR filed One should only register once and all the details will be available online. If you open the file by Registration No. and Mobile No. all details will be appearing. The softfare should be containing all columns in one form of one person. 9. This will ease the RTO to trace the vehicle on accident/ overspeed/licence/Pollution/ signal cut etc. can be traced fast by noting down the Registration No. 10. This practice is existing in US, UK and Gulf countires. 11. We should gear up fast by not wasting time to ease the public in getting the work done quick and genuinely without harrassment. 12. The very fact that there are MIDDLE MEN in most of the interaction between Govt Deptt. and general public is LACK of circulated useful information for the purpose of work to be done. There are NO HELP DESK at the Govt Deptt which can guide the common man. The information required to get work done is very sketchy and the MIDDLE MAN has knowledge of all necessary methods and means. We need to submit E Data to stay away from most of the Govt deptt and to ensure that all the necessary forms should be available On- line. The digitization of govt. services being pursued by the Govt. is a step forward which will benefit users in urban centers and ensure that the middle men are kept out, however it is the rural areas that need to be given more help, establishing a single window help centre, managed by a private organization/NGO, which can help with the requirements of of the people in rural areas, Something similar to "Bangalore one", which has helped citizens a lot when availing govt. services and also avoid middle men at the same time, Also educating the populace of govt. procedures helps a lot in ensuring that middle men are kept out, Investment needs to be made in this regard, The success of PM Jan Dhan yojna is a recent example of how education through media is helpfull, We will get more success stories more
